CVE-2023-29596

HIGHCVSS 7.8/10EPSS 0.33%

Last modified

CVE-2023-29596 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 7.8/10 on the CVSS scale. Buffer Overflow vulnerability found in ByronKnoll Cmix v.19 allows an attacker to execute arbitrary code and cause a denial of service via the paq8 function.. EPSS estimates a 0.33%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
